    MJ I will send your angel your real name and your online name and all of the info you sent to me. They will know who you are and you will not know who they are. Then I will send you all of the same infor on a diffrent person. You will know who they are but they will not know who you are. You will send to them small gifts and cards without a return address, or with their own address as a return address. Don't send a real name or online name. If you wnat to make up a name for this then you can do that, but don't use it on line. I think I may have come up with a name for me. At the end of 2010 we will send a final gift and reveal ourselves to our partner.
